Special R&D & Experimental Line for Cleaning Equipment

Our company has built a dedicated R&D and experimental line for cleaning equipment. This platform is a professional innovation carrier developed to meet the R&D and production requirements of cleaning equipment. It deeply integrates three core capabilities: process processing, precision measurement, and performance verification. It enables full-process technical verification and data traceability of cleaning equipment from technical pre-research to product finalization, providing critical support for equipment technological iteration and upgrading, performance parameter optimization, and core consumable adaptation verification.
The experimental R&D line covers a total area of 2,500 square meters, including 200 square meters of Class 10 clean area, 500 square meters of Class 100 clean area, and 1,000 square meters of Class 1000 clean area. The spatial layout strictly complies with high-end cleaning equipment R&D standards. The experimental line is divided into three functional modules: process processing zone, precision measurement zone, and data analysis zone. It is equipped with a full-chain process system covering pre-treatment, core processing, and post-treatment, as well as multi-dimensional precision measuring instruments including topography characterization, composition analysis, stress detection, and defect identification. It has established an integrated closed-loop R&D system of "processing – inspection – analysis – optimization", laying a solid foundation for the efficient R&D and quality assurance of cleaning equipment.

Relying on its complete equipment configuration, this R&D line has three core technical capabilities to comprehensively support cleaning equipment R&D:
Multi-dimensional process analysis capability: cleaning effect analysis, process compatibility analysis, and damage risk analysis.
Equipment performance verification capability: new equipment prototype verification, key component performance testing, and stability & reliability testing.
Consumable evaluation capability: cleaning medium evaluation, consumable life evaluation, and environmentally friendly consumable verification.
